Kansas State University–Salina | Manufacturing Apprentice I

*PLEASE NOTE: This opportunity is available exclusively for college students currently enrolled at Kansas State University-Salina, in Salina, KS.

Students who are not enrolled full-time at K-State Salina are not eligible to apply.

Great Plains Manufacturing has partnered with Kansas State University-Salina for the GPM Scholars Program! The GPM Scholars Program is a paid apprenticeship and scholarship opportunity exclusively for students enrolled full-time at Kansas State University-Salina in Salina, KS.

Participation requires a year-round commitment: scholars must attend K-State Salina during the fall, spring, and summer terms and work year-round as a Manufacturing Apprentice at Great Plains Manufacturing for a minimum of 20 hours per week. The accelerated academic plan is designed to support completion of a bachelor’s degree in three years while providing substantial, relevant work experience.

Program Structure
  • Attend K-State Salina full-time year-round, including the Fall, Spring, and Summer terms.
  • Work year-round as a Manufacturing Apprentice at a Great Plains Manufacturing facility for a minimum of 20 hours per week, generally two 10-hour days.
  • Rotate through departments such as Assembly, Fabrication, Welding, Material Handling, and Engineering Support.
  • Complete more than 2,400 hours of relevant on-the-job training by graduation.
Compensation and Scholarship
  • Hourly wage: $15.00 per hour, plus part-time benefits, while working at least 20 hours per week.
  • Annual scholarship: Up to $10,000, awarded by K-State Salina—up to $3,333 in each fall, spring, and summer semester.
  • Tuition support: The scholarship may cover 85% or more of the in-state tuition rate.

Training Experience

Scholars receive hands-on training across a range of manufacturing and technical areas, including:

  • Welding robot operation and automation
  • Welding robot programming
  • New-product design layout and product flow
  • Troubleshooting
Eligibility Requirements
  • K-State Salina Students enrolled Full-Time (at least 12 credit hours per semester) in an Engineering or Manufacturing program. Students who are not enrolled full-time at K-State Salina are not eligible to apply.
  • Eligible degree programs include: Mechanical Engineering Technology, Robotics, Automation Engineering Technology, Electronic Engineering, Computer Engineering Technology, and other related degree programs.
  • Maintain a college GPA of 2.8 or higher.
  • Be available to work year-round as a Manufacturing Apprentice for a minimum of 20 hours per week while maintaining full-time enrollment.
  • Be available to attend K-State Salina year-round, including during the summer term, while pursuing an accelerated three-year Bachelor of Science degree plan.

Selection Process

Recipients are selected during the fall semester of their first year at K-State Salina. Selection is based on:

  • Recommendations from K-State Salina professors
  • On-site interviews with Great Plains Manufacturing managers
  • Demonstrated ability to attend K-State Salina full-time during the fall, spring, and summer terms and work year-round as a Manufacturing Apprentice for at least 20 hours per week

Program Outcomes

GPM Scholars can graduate with a Bachelor of Science degree in just 3 years, with limited student debt, more than 2,400 hours of professional experience, and additional earnings and part-time benefits while in college.

Great Plains Manufacturing, headquartered in Salina, KS, is a proud subsidiary of Kubota with more than 50 years as a Kansas leader in the design, engineering and manufacturing of agricultural implements, including seeding, tillage, and landscaping equipment. Our new Construction Equipment Division adds Kubota-branded skid steers, compact track loaders, and CE attachments, supported by Kubota Construction R&D Engineering in Salina. Operating in eight Kansas communities with multiple divisions, including Great Plains Ag; Land Pride; Great Plains International; and the Construction Equipment Division, we employ over 2,000 people and are committed to innovation and professional growth.
